One of the most valuable features of the Inspire series — and the Inspire 3 in particular — is the ability to fly in dual-operator mode, with a pilot focused on navigation and a camera operator dedicated solely to framing. Each has their own remote and real-time HD video feed. This is ideal for dynamic and precise tracking shots: vehicles on circuits, boats at high speed, or complex moves in urban and industrial environments — up to 90 km/h — while maintaining full flight safety.Demo clip of the Inspire 3 drone in flight, filmed by our Mavic 4 Pro, at the Domaine de Saint-Ser, Puyloubier

But a new chapter begins. The Inspire 3 is a cutting-edge aerial cinematography platform, unlike anything else in DJI’s lineup. It’s the only drone combining dual-operator control and interchangeable lenses, with full-frame coverage from 14mm to 90mm, capable of shooting up to 8.1K at 75 fps in ProRes RAW. ✦ Seamless compatibility with RED and ARRI Alexa cameras
The Inspire 3 with Zenmuse X9-8K Air was designed to meet cinema production standards, both technically and artistically — in image quality, dynamic range, codecs, and post-production workflow. It’s no longer just a “drone with good image” — it’s a flying cinema camera, able to stand alongside the industry’s top gear.
🔹 Cinematic image quality
- Full-frame 35mm sensor, equivalent to a RED V-Raptor or Alexa LF — for similar depth of field, bokeh and low-light control
- Dual native ISO (320 & 1600) and wide dynamic range up to 14+ stops, ensuring perfect matching on high-contrast or natural light scenes
- Sophisticated color science, with support for cinema LUTs (REC709, D-Log, etc.) — simplifying grading consistency
🔹 Professional recording codecs
- Apple ProRes and CinemaDNG RAW are post-production standards used in RED/Alexa workflows, ensuring:
- Seamless editing and grading with no transcoding
- Maximum preservation of detail, color and exposure latitude
- Native RAW recording for full creative control
🔹 Editorial consistency
- DL-mount prime lenses and D-Log gamma allow Inspire 3 footage to perfectly match RED Komodo/V-Raptor or Alexa Mini shots, maintaining textural and tonal consistency
- High resolution (up to 8.1K) supports cropping, stabilization, or VFX work with no visible loss, just like RED 6K/8K footage
✦ Unmatched flight stability and smoothness
Compared to the Inspire 2, flight stability has significantly improved. This enables slow, low, or extremely tight tracking shots with zero jitters — even in wind — for precise and cinematic movement. Key features include:- Dolly 3D with programmable waypoints, for repeatable flight paths — ideal for parallax shots or multi-take sequences
- Customizable Tripod Mode, for ultra-slow, ultra-precise motion — great in tight indoor or architectural environments
✦ RC Plus remote: built for the set
The new RC Plus controller elevates on-set comfort:- Zero-latency HD video feeds for both pilot (via FPV camera) and camera operator (via X9-8K Air)
- 7-inch ultra-bright touchscreen, built-in, no external monitor needed
- Comprehensive ports: HDMI, USB, USB-C for director’s village or live monitoring
- Long battery life, ergonomic design, and harness-supported weight distribution
✦ Optimized autonomy & hot-swappable batteries
The Inspire 3 runs on two TB51 batteries, offering a real-world flight time of 15 to 17 minutes (not the 26–28 mins advertised!). Better still: batteries are hot-swappable, allowing you to replace one at a time without powering off, keeping connections intact and saving valuable shoot time.
✦ Unrivaled image quality = limitless creativity
The Zenmuse X9-8K Air pushes the boundaries:- Full-frame 35mm sensor for crisp detail, rich dynamic range and shallow DOF
- Dual ISO, with clean low-light performance even at ISO 6400 — ideal for dawn, dusk or night shoots
- 4K slow-motion at 120 fps, perfect for stylized sequences
- 70° upward tilt with no props in frame (from 18mm upward), thanks to the front-mounted gimbal — a game-changer for architectural or creative shots
✦ Professional formats and codecs
The Inspire 3 supports all industry-grade recording formats:- Apple ProRes 422 HQ and ProRes RAW
- CinemaDNG RAW
- H.264 (for lightweight workflows)
✦ Interchangeable DL prime lenses: cinema-style control
Our current lens kit includes:
DJI DL 18mm, 24mm, 35mm, 50mm f/2.8 LS ASPH
LAOWA DL 9mm f/2.8 (14mm equivalent in Super35mm – max 5.5K resolution)
DL 75mm available on request
✦ Full compliance with EU and French regulations – C5 kit
Our Inspire 3 is equipped with the C5 European classification kit and Flying-Eye parachutes, making it fully compliant with urban flight scenarios under STS-01 (Specific category) and DGAC S3 regulation in France.
